Responsibilities Protect all company assets and reduce losses. Supervise Loss Prevention team, including scheduling, training, and performance management. Monitor inventory loss and crime trends; meet shrink targets, lead investigations and ensure appropriate emergency response. Maintain effective liaison with public safety authorities, law enforcement, vendors, and other security professionals. Be cognizant of and report issues which could adversely affect the morale of employees. Ensure compliance with licensing, regulatory requirements, and company policies. Oversee the use of physical security systems and ensure safe, legal, and ethical practices. Maintain accurate records, complete payroll and administrative tasks, and ensure documentation meets standards. Deliver approved training programs and support team development. Operate the prescribed store level Loss Prevention, security, and audit programs. Represent Loss Prevention in interdepartmental meetings and lead collaborative projects. Respond to afterhours emergencies and attend select locations as required. Travel to company locations or industry events as needed. Carry communication tools and respond to afterhours emergencies as required. Carry keys, access cards, codes to attend and open select locations (in order to respond to emergencies). Qualifications Demonstrated interpersonal, conflict resolution, collaboration, and communication skills. Ability to stay calm and respond with good judgment in emergency situations. Demonstrated ability to work under strict confidentiality. Highly organized and able to adapt to shifting priorities. Strong supervisory and leadership skills with effective delegation and followup. Conscientious in meeting schedules and deadlines. Strong strategic and critical thinking skills. Ability to assess, plan, and respond to crime trends and vulnerabilities. Proficient in Microsoft Office and BI tools is an asset. Willingness to assist others and pursue selfdevelopment and training. Education & Knowledge Formal education in security operations, criminal justice, or a related field; or an equivalent combination of education and experience. Understanding of retail loss prevention practices, security systems, and applicable laws and regulations. Provincial security worker license and tactical training (depending on jurisdiction). Understanding rights and obligations for arrest and application of force. Industry certifications such as LPQ, CFI, or APP are preferred. Experience in coaching, conflict management, and structured interview techniques. Completion of London Drugs leadership and LP training programs or equivalents. First Aid.
